WORLD CHAMPIONSHIP WRESTLING RETURNS!
WCW presents Slamboree -- The Big Bang Announced For 2nd Week May 2001
World Championship Wrestling and business partners Fusient Media Ventures are pleased to announce that their upcoming event, WCW presents Slamboree -- The Big Bang, will be broadcast on pay-per-view throughout the United States via Bright House Communications PPV service. Additionally, fans may order the show online at http://www.wcwwrestling.com via streaming PPV services for the first time in company history! WCW and Fusient are proud to lead professional wrestling into the new media age by embracing the online community and marketing to that community in new and exciting ways, such as streaming PPV services and interactive programming features planned for future events.

Main eventing Slamboree -- The Big Bang will be a three-way dance for the WCW World Heavyweight title as champion Booker T steps into the ring to defend against two of the biggest stars in professional wrestling today! Former champion "Big Poppa Pump" Scott Steiner will be looking to regain to his title, but he won't just need to avenge his loss to Booker T from the company's last edition of Monday Nitro on TNT as the one and only "Diamond" Dallas Page returns looking for gold.

Also to be featured is an eight-man tournament to crown a new WCW United States Champion. In his last act of power before new management officially took office, former CEO of World Championship Wrestling "Nature Boy" Ric Flair released a statement declaring that if the company were to thrive, the future of the company could not rely on just one man to be the face as both World Heavyweight Champion and United State Champion. With the tradition of great former WCW United States champions such as Ricky "The Dragon" Steamboat, Wahoo McDaniel, and Greg "The Hammer" Valentine in mind, Flair picked eight of WCW's brightest stars to compete in the one night tournament for the second most prized possesion in World Championship Wrestling! No official participants have been announced, but the wrestling world has been buzzing with rumors ever since the backstage video of Flair was posted on wcwwrestling.com shortly after Nitro went off the air. Everyone from recent champions such as "The Franchise" Shane Douglas and Lance Storm to WCW mainstays like "The Icon" Sting and "The Total Package" Lex Luger, and a whole host of the hottest free agents in professional wrestling.

An official announcement of tournment particpates will be released in the coming in the coming days as new President of World Championship Wrestling Eric Bischoff and management continue the process of renegotiating contracts with talent as the company enters the post-Turner Broadcasting-era. WCW is proud to have great fans who have stuck with stuck with them through invasions, reboots, and near-death experiences and the company are confident they will be happy with their rewards as broadcasting & touring stabilize.

WCW Cruiserweight Champion "Sugar" Shane Helms is set to defend his title against one of the best in the division, Chavo Guerrero Jr. of the legendary Guerrero wrestling family. His fans believe Helms represents the future of not just the cruiserweight division, but perhaps the sport of wrestling as a whole while Guerrero believes WCW needs a champion with his sort of legacy as it enters the new era. Will it be a bit of futureshock, or will tradition prevail when these two high flying superstars clash?

Recently in WCW, a group known as the Natural Born Thrillers has been racking up wins over all sorts of competition. Once a much larger gang, an open message was issues via wcwwrestling.com by the trio of Chuck Palumbo, Sean O'Haire, and Mark Jindrak stating that, going forward, that the trio, and only the three of them, would be known as the Natural Born Thrillers. Palumbo & O'Haire dared any tag team in professional wrestling to show up at Slamboree -- The Big Bang and try to take the WCW World Tag Team titles from them, and much like the buzz surronding participants for the WCW United State Title Tournament, the rumor mill has been working overtime with duos who may arrive to challenge the brash young champions. Will anyone answer the call at all?

And finally, former WCW Cruiserweight Tag Team champions Team Canada, Elix Skipper and Kid Romeo, have invoked their rematch clause after losing the belts to Billy Kidman & Rey Mysterio Jr., The Filthy Animals, on the final Monday Nitro on TNT. . . sort of. When negotiating with new management, Team Canada refused to sign new contracts unless their rematch for Slamboree -- The Big Bang was guaranteed, and with the champions more than willing to grant the rematch anyway, the rematch is now set to take place!

All of this and more in just three weeks when World Championship Wrestling presents Slamboree -- The Big Bang!

LATEST WCW NEWS & RUMORS
AOL-TIME WARNER PAYING SOME BILLS; CONFIRMED SIGNINGS; US TITLE TOURNAMENT PARTICIPANTS
Word going around among WCW talent is that AOL-Time Warner is assisting Fusient financially with some of the contract buyouts the company is negotiating. This was likely a stipulation of the sale, as Eric Bischoff is saavy enough to know he couldn't afford some talents due to the financial strain of their long, guaranteed contracts. None of the released talent have come forward and said that their contracts were bought out by the former owners of WCW. It is highly suspected that workers like Sid Vicious, Goldberg, Kevin Nash, and perhaps even Sting will either have their deals bought out or sit through their guaranteed contracts.

In somewhat related news, word is that the next round of releases announced will include some of the companies over-priced midcard. This potentially puts guys like Hugh Morrus, Brian Adams, Bryan Clarke (Wrath), and Mike Awesome at risk. Morrus is long-employed with a bloated contract due to years of service, Adams & Clarke were given big contracts as former WWF guys, and Awesome got a huge deal with the plan for him to appear on television with the ECW World title before an injuction stopped that.

All of the talent in the recent press release are confirmed to have deals transfered over to the new company, as well as Shane Douglas, Lance Storm, and Dustin Rhodes as announced by Eric Bischoff on their website. Jeff Jarrett is expected to be announced soon, and sources say that Bischoff has been negotiating tirelessly with Sting for a deal that will lure him into the fold.

Mark Jindrak is expected to be added to the US title tournament, as is Jeff Jarrett once a deal is completed.
